The Current State of Recruitment: Drowning in Data, Thirsty for Insight

Today’s recruitment landscape is characterized by a relentless torrent of applications, a struggle to identify top talent quickly, and an overwhelming amount of manual, repetitive tasks. Recruiters often spend countless hours sifting through resumes, scheduling interviews, and managing candidate communications – tasks that, while essential, detract from their ability to engage meaningfully with high-potential candidates. This labor-intensive approach leads to slower time-to-hire, increased operational costs, and a higher risk of human error and bias, compromising the quality of talent acquisition. Legacy systems, often siloed, only compound these issues, preventing a holistic view of the candidate journey and an agile response to market demands.

Identifying Bottlenecks Ripe for AI Intervention

The key to successful AI implementation isn’t a blanket approach, but a surgical one, targeting specific points of friction within your existing processes. Our OpsMap™ diagnostic routinely uncovers areas within recruitment that are prime candidates for AI-driven automation. Consider the initial screening phase: thousands of resumes arrive, each needing review. AI can automate the parsing and initial assessment of these documents against predefined criteria, dramatically reducing the manual load. Think about interview scheduling, candidate communication, or even initial qualification calls – these are all areas where AI, properly integrated, can streamline operations, ensure consistency, and allow your human talent acquisition specialists to focus on the nuanced, human-centric aspects of their role. It’s about leveraging AI to accelerate the administrative, not replace the strategic.

Automating the Mundane to Elevate Human Expertise

The true power of AI in recruitment isn’t about replacing people; it’s about empowering them to perform at their highest potential. By automating tasks like initial resume screening, scheduling, and even personalized candidate outreach, AI frees up recruiters from the low-value, high-volume work that consumes so much of their day. This shift allows your high-value employees to dedicate more time to strategic sourcing, building relationships with top talent, negotiating offers, and improving the overall candidate experience – activities that genuinely require human empathy, judgment, and expertise.
